Understanding Locking Welded Hydraulic Cylinders
Locking welded hydraulic cylinders are essential components in hydraulic systems, providing a secure way to hold loads without pressure. They play a crucial role in various industries, including construction, agriculture, and manufacturing.


Design and Construction Characteristics
- Locking Mechanism – Safety: These cylinders feature a specific locking device that maintains load stability, ensuring safety and simplifying operation for improved efficiency.
- Durable Materials – High-Strength Steel: Typically made of high-strength steel, these cylinders offer enhanced durability, compression resistance, and anti-corrosion coating for longevity in harsh environments.
- Compact Design – Space Saving: Their compact design makes them suitable for applications with limited space, offering versatility for use in various equipment.
Working Principle of Locking Welded Hydraulic Cylinders
These cylinders operate by transferring force through a liquid medium, causing the piston to move and perform the desired workload. The sealing system ensures pressure release when needed, maintaining optimal performance.
